How they compare
Georgia currently reports 175.39 against 153.08 in Kuwait, a difference of 22.31.
That makes Georgia's figure about 1.1 times Kuwait's.
The two have swapped places 8 times across 31 shared years of data; in 1994 it was Georgia ahead.
Georgia ranks 2nd and Kuwait ranks 5th of 84 countries.
Across the 4 decades both report, Georgia averaged higher in 3 and Kuwait in 1.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Georgia | Kuwait |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 129.85 | 10.02 | 119.83 | Georgia |
| 2000s | 92.11 | 18.17 | 73.94 | Georgia |
| 2010s | 105.34 | 106.13 | 0.793 | Kuwait |
| 2020s | 155.38 | 150.59 | 4.79 | Georgia |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
The FAO indices of agricultural production show the relative level of the aggregate volume of agricultural production for each year in comparison with the base period 2014-2016. Indices for meat production are computed based on data on production from indigenous animals.
